### Runbook: Lampwick rollout framework

If a flag rollout stalls in Lampwick, first check the evaluator pods for backpressure, then confirm the targeting ruleset compiled cleanly in the admin console. Stuck rollouts can be force-advanced, but only after the affected team confirms. Kill-switch flags bypass staged percentages entirely and take effect within one poll interval. Before touching anything, verify the evaluator is running with the expected settings, which are listed below.

settings of fafog-haduf:
ZORIX_PIN=4648
ZORIX_METRICS_HOST=metrics.zorix.paliqsys.corp
ZORIX_LOG_LEVEL=info
ZORIX_TENANT=druix

## SDK Parity Checks — On-Call Notes

The Corvessa platform ships two client SDKs, Kestrel (mobile) and Marrow (server), and the nightly parity suite diffs their method surfaces and wire payloads. If the suite pages you, first check whether one SDK shipped ahead of the other; most alerts are release skew, not bugs. Re-running the suite requires publishing a signed parity report to the internal feed. The key used to sign that report is below.

deploy key for kajof-fajop: bky6_gDHw9Q

# Tax-rate lookup cache (Fennick Billing)
# Support: if rates look stale, flush the cache via the admin CLI,
# not by editing rows. Entries expire after 6 hours.
# Do not point this at the reporting replica — rates there lag.
# The cache warms itself from the primary rates store, reached via the connection below.

warehouse DSN: mssql://druius_svc:aJ@db-b2f3.xolmarhq.local:5432/soreth

## Changelog — Ticktrace 1.9

### Renamed: DRIFT_API_TOKEN
During the cron drift investigation we found plugins confusing this variable with the metrics token, so it has been renamed to indicate it authorizes drift-report uploads specifically. Plugin authors must read the new name from 1.9 onward; the old name is ignored without warning. Sample env files in the SDK are updated. In your deployment env file, the drift-report upload secret is set on the next line.

env line for fawef-taguf: VAULT_KEY13=a9695905a9a90